BET Networks Is in Search of America's Best Undiscovered Rapper

BET'S NEW REALITY COMPETITION SERIES "ONE SHOT" PREMIERES TUESDAY, AUGUST 23 AT 10 PM ET/PT ON BET

Iconic Hip Hop and Radio Personality Sway Calloway to Host Series

Celebrity Guest Judges to Join Each Week Including T.I., RZA, DJ Khaled, Twista, Tech N9ne and DJ Drama

Emcees will battle for a chance to win a cash prize of $100,000, a record deal with SMH Entertainment and nationwide fame

NEW YORK -- Now, what you hear is not a test! BET Networks is on a nationwide search to find America's next big rap star. BET announced today the series premiere of its high-octane hip hop lyrical competition series ONE SHOT. The talent competition will scour the nation to find the next explosive rap star with mass appeal, on-the-fly musicianship and command of the stage.

Hosted by iconic hip hop and radio personality Sway Calloway, the six one-hour episode series will premiere Tuesday, August 23 at 10 PM ET/PT on BET. Each episode travels to a different city: Atlanta, Charlotte, Miami and Chicago where contestants will face off to secure his or her spot at the grand finale in New York City. The show's judges feature an elite roster of industry experts including Mike Smith, Kxng Crooked and King Tech. They will be joined each week by different celebrity guest judges including T.I., RZA, DJ Khaled, Twista, Tech N9ne and DJ Drama and together will critique and offer guidance to the hip hop hopefuls and handpick the best of the crop. While thousands of talented men and women applied, only the nation's hottest emcees were selected to compete for a cash prize of $100,000, a record deal with SMH Entertainment and bragging rights to be named America's hottest emcee.

All is at stake for the contestants. ONE SHOT will give viewers a bird's eye view of what it takes to be the greatest in the game and reveal the sacrifices many hip hop stars must make to accomplish their goals and dreams. In the end, only one will drop the mic and win the coveted title of America's number one rap star.

ONE SHOT is executive produced by Sway Calloway, Mike Smith, Dominick Wickliffe p/k/a "Kxng Crooked", Rod Sepand p/k/a "King Tech", Nancy Nayor and Dean Hadaegh. Zach Hermann and Erika Smith serve as Co-Executive Producers. Julie Insogna Jarrett and Seth Jarrett will also serve as Executive Producers for production company, Jarrett Creative. Kenny Hull serves as Executive Producer and series show runner. The show concept was created by Kxng Crooked.
